Miss Clara, Stockholm



Beginning
life as an all-girls school in 1910, the iconic
art-nouveau building which houses boutique Stockholm hotel Miss
Clara
has come a long way since the days when students walked
its halls. But while it’s named after one of the most fondly
remembered headmistresses of the institution, you’ll find nothing
to remind you of chalkboards and textbooks – so fret not that
memories of elasticated gym knickers will hit you on check-in.
Instead, thanks to a sleek renovation from award-winning architect
Gert Wingardh, low-key Scandi minimalism combines with industrial
glamour for a designer stay you’ll be Instagramming for weeks.

Behind an impressive façade on one of Stockholm’s main strips,
seductive interiors make use of retro furnishings, feminine touches
and plenty of dark wood panelling, exuding a warmth often missing
from Scandi design. And with its prime location, you won’t have to
